LOA 15-14 Remote Gas Transmission Estimator HQ’s
GT Estimating will be considered a separate HQ from GD Estimating at every office where there are remote GT Estimators; Existing incumbent GT Estimators are transferred to separate HQ’s. All future GT Estimator vacancies will be filled by bidding with the new contractual HQ’s.

LOA 15-13 DCPP QV Rotations
Establishes a process and outlines restrictions for IBEW and Management employees to rotate into QV positions for up to two year.

LOA 15-12 Canus Treated as Hiring Hall for Title 27.2
Provides that Hiring Hall employees who choose to work through Canus instead of PG&E Hiring Hall will be treated like Hiring Hall for purposes of the ESC contract.

LOA 15-11 Expert Project Controls Analyst (PCA)
Establishes new classification of Expert PCA, job description, qualifications and salary range plus four separate contractual HQ’s for PCA’s in Gas Ops at Bishop Ranch.

LOA 15-10 (Supersedes LOA 15-02) Mapper Advancement Program and Mapping Pay Steps
Mapper training period is now 2 years instead of 3. New pay steps provide faster pay progression. A new Senior Passed Test rate, and new structure and provisions for training programs established.

LOA 15-09 Unanticipated Vacation Clarification
Clarifies that vacation requests before the end of the previous workday are counted as regular vacation, not unanticipated vacation usage.

LOA 15-07 SmartMeter Operations Center (SMOC)
Clarifies job descriptions, salary ranges and unique working conditions for newly organized classifications in SmartMeter Operations Center: IT Applications Analysts, Business Analysts, Systems Analysts. SmartMeter Engineers are combined into Meter Engineer classification.

LOA 15-05 Gas Distribution Clearances To Be Written by FET/FE’s and Estimators
Establishes that writing clearance procedures for Gas work is ESC Local 20 represented work, and explains which classifications and departments do this task in different situations.

LOA 15-04 Waive Oakland Measure FF (Paid Sick Leave)
Waives Oakland city measure in order to keep all sick leave provisions consistent in the contract.
